Friday preview: Halifax house prices in focus

(Sharecast News) - There are no FTSE 350 companies of note due to report on Friday as the pre-Christmas lull begins to take hold. On the macro front, the latest Halifax UK house price index is due at 0700 GMT, while German factory orders for October will be released at the same time.

Eurozone third-quarter GDP and employment change figures are due at 1000 GMT.

Across the pond, the CPE index for September is at 1330 GMT, with the preliminary Michigan consumer sentiment index for December at 1500 GMT.
